软件开发文档编制规范的重要性
在软件开发过程中,制定并遵循合理的文档编制规范至关重要。良好的软件开发文档编制规范不仅能够提高团队协作效率,还能确保项目的可维护性和可扩展性。本文将详细介绍软件开发文档编制规范的关键要素,帮助开发团队打造高质量的项目文档。
软件开发文档的类型及其作用
软件开发文档涵盖了项目生命周期的各个阶段,包括需求分析、系统设计、编码实现、测试验证和维护运营等。常见的文档类型有:需求规格说明书、系统架构设计文档、详细设计文档、测试计划和报告、用户手册等。这些文档在项目管理、知识传承和质量控制方面发挥着重要作用。
为了有效管理这些文档,许多团队选择使用专业的研发管理工具。ONES研发管理平台提供了强大的文档协作和知识库管理功能,可以帮助团队更好地组织和维护各类开发文档。
文档编制规范的核心原则
1. 一致性:保持文档格式、术语使用和风格的一致性,有助于提高文档的可读性和专业性。
2. 完整性:确保文档内容全面覆盖相关主题,包括必要的背景信息、详细说明和注意事项。
3. 准确性:所有信息必须准确无误,及时更新过时的内容,保持文档的时效性。
4. 可追溯性:建立清晰的版本控制机制,记录文档的修改历史和责任人。
5. 易读性:使用清晰简洁的语言,合理运用图表和示例,提高文档的可理解性。
文档模板的设计与使用
制定标准化的文档模板是实施软件开发文档编制规范的重要一步。好的模板应包括以下要素:
1. 文档标题和版本信息
2. 修订历史记录
3. 目录结构
4. 相关参考文档链接
5. 术语表和缩略语解释
6. 正文内容框架
7. 附录(如有)
使用统一的文档模板可以大大提高文档编写的效率和质量。ONES研发管理平台提供了丰富的文档模板库,团队可以根据自身需求进行定制和管理,确保所有成员都能按照规范编写文档。
文档审核和维护流程
为确保文档质量,建立严格的审核和维护流程至关重要:
1. 制定明确的文档审核标准和检查清单。
2. 实施多级审核机制,包括同行评审和专家审核。
3. 建立定期文档更新计划,确保内容始终保持最新状态。
4. 使用版本控制工具管理文档的演进历史。
5. 设置文档访问权限,保护敏感信息。
6. 收集用户反馈,持续优化文档内容和结构。
在实施这些流程时,选择合适的工具平台可以极大地提高效率。ONES研发管理平台集成了文档版本控制、权限管理和审批流程等功能,能够有效支持团队的文档管理需求。
文档规范的执行和培训
制定了规范后,最关键的是确保团队成员能够严格执行。以下是一些有效的实施策略:
1. 组织专门的文档编写培训,确保所有成员理解并掌握规范要求。
2. 制作简明的文档编写指南,方便团队成员随时查阅。
3. 设立文档质量奖励机制,鼓励成员积极参与文档编制和改进。
4. 定期举行文档评审会议,分享最佳实践和经验教训。
5. 利用自动化工具辅助文档规范检查,提高效率和准确性。
通过这些措施,可以逐步建立起团队的文档编制文化,提高整体文档质量。
结语
掌握并实施有效的软件开发文档编制规范,是提升项目质量和团队效率的关键举措。通过建立统一的文档标准、使用合适的工具平台、实施严格的审核流程和持续的培训,开发团队可以显著提高文档的质量和可用性。在日益复杂的软件开发环境中,良好的文档编制规范将成为项目成功的重要保障。让我们共同努力,将软件开发文档编制规范贯彻到每一个项目中,为团队的长远发展奠定坚实基础。